After smashing through a home’s ceiling, a black bear was discovered resting on a stove in Bell County, Kentucky on May 21. A bear inside a home prompted a call to Game Warden Derick Creech. Creech found the bear sitting on the kitchen stove, where it had fallen from the attic above through the ceiling.

Tulip Lake in the Botanical Garden of Jundiaí, a Brazilian town near São Paulo, has become deep blue due to a chemical accident. The event occurred when a vehicle carrying five 1,000-liter dye tanks collapsed, spilling considerable amounts of liquid into the area.
